Nunez Community College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

During the 2019-2020 academic year, part-time undergraduate students at Nunez Community College paid an average of $139 per credit hour. No discount was available for in-state students.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$3,335 $3,335
Fees $920 $920
Books and Supplies $1,625 $1,625

Nunez Community College Liberal Arts AA Student Debt

One way to think about how much a school will cost is to look at how much in student loans that you have to take out to get your degree. Liberal Arts students who received their associate degree at Nunez Community College took out an average of $12,250 in student loans. That is 9% higher than the national average of $11,188.

How Much Can You Make With an AA in Liberal Arts From Nunez Community College?

$25,774 Average Salary
High Earnings Boost

liberal arts who receive their associate degree from Nunez Community College make an average of $25,774 a year during the early days of their career. That is 8% higher than the national average of $23,781.

Does Nunez Community College Offer an Online AA in Liberal Arts?

Nunez Community College does not offer an online option for its liberal arts associate deg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the Nunez Community College Online Learning page.

Nunez Community College Associate Student Diversity for Liberal Arts

56 Associate Degrees Awarded
64.3% Women
53.6%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
During the 2019-2020 academic year, there were 56 associate degrees in liberal arts handed out to qualified students. The charts and tables below give more information about these students.

Male-to-Female Ratio

Of the students who received their associate degree in liberal arts in 2019-2020, 64.3% of them were women. This is in the same ballpark of the nationwide number of 63.0%.

undefined

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Of those graduates who received an associate degree in liberal arts at Nunez Community College in 2019-2020, 53.6% were racial-ethnic minorities*. This is higher than the nationwide number of 46%.
